Dismantle ICE & relegate its functions to agencies with clear limits & oversight

To: Rep. Jayapal, Sen. Murray, Sen. Cantwell

From: A constituent in Seattle, WA

January 13

Renee Nicole Good, killed by an ICE agent in Minneapolis was an American citizen, a mother, and a legal observer. Her death is tragic, but it is not isolated. In 2025 alone, many have died while in ICE custody or during ICE operations. This is not the hallmark of a professional law-enforcement agency operating with discipline and restraint. A government agency that routinely denies medical care, obstructs congressional oversight, escalates encounters, and responds to public scrutiny with secrecy and propaganda is an agency that cannot be trusted with expanded power. Flooding cities with heavily armed federal agents, while restricting congressional oversight and expanding recruitment through “wartime” rhetoric, is not strength. It is instability. ICE did not exist before 2003. The United States enforced immigration law for generations without it. Congress created ICE, and Congress has the authority—and responsibility—to dismantle it when it becomes dangerous. I urge you to take the following actions: • Support legislation to dismantle ICE and redistribute any necessary functions under agencies with clear limits, transparent rules, and real oversight. • Freeze funding for ICE expansion and mass recruitment until Congress completes a full investigation into use-of-force policies, medical care failures, and detainee deaths. • Hold public hearings to restore congressional authority and reaffirm that no federal agency operates above the law. Please act NOW before more lives are lost or ruined.
